Prepare Packages

Our codebase require Python ≥ 3.9. Please run the following commands to prepare the environments.

conda create -n planner python=3.9 conda activate planner python -m pip install numpy torch==2.0.0.dev20230208+cu117 --index-url https://download.pytorch.org/whl/nightly/cu117 python -m pip install -r requirements.txt python -m pip install git+https://github.com/MineDojo/MineCLIP

Prepare Environment

It also requires a modified version of MineDojo as the simulator and a goal-conditioned controller.

git clone https://github.com/CraftJarvis/MC-Simulator.git cd MC-Simulator pip install -e .

Prepare OpenAI keys

Our planner depends on Large Language Model like InstructGPT, Codex or ChatGPT. So we need support the OpenAI keys in the file data/openai_keys.txt. An OpenAI key list is also accepted.

Running agent models

To run the code, call

python main.py model.load_ckpt_path=<path/to/ckpt>

After loading, you should see a window where agents are playing Minecraft.
